Output 86ebd96ec33ee4927310a2ffc241029f3437f5902294e8465a509f8ed47b2220:14
- value
- 34366564
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 440f0cf976808b039bbab9dbfe9143af24c5a338 OP_EQUAL
- address
- 37tsuKyL5Z7bVyPSmnKbfRbDRBmb9vUDza
- transaction
- 86ebd96ec33ee4927310a2ffc241029f3437f5902294e8465a509f8ed47b2220
- confirmations
- 426901
- spent
- true